you cant be serious !! putting a VQ23 into a W124 ?

then may i suggest a VQ35 instead... if it can fly a plane, it can propel you along NS comfortably

but the problem with swopping blocks from other manufacturers is that the mounting points are different + tranny are different.

makes the whole conversion exercise laborious and painful

moreover, it screws the weight balance and distribution ... handling can be a chore

the V6 is fun ... but i dont think its worth the hassle.

i think a "hairdryer" is the best way forward

even if kenna Lorong 8 .... its stil only 800 buckaroos

the price of a brethren swap is definitely more expensive than that
